House leveling services involve adjusting the foundation of a home to correct uneven or settling floors, cracks, and structural issues. This process typically addresses projects such as foundation settlement, shifting soil, or uneven ground that causes a home to become unlevel. Homeowners interested in this service usually want to understand the methods used to stabilize and raise the foundation, the types of signs indicating a need for leveling, and how the process can protect the property’s structural integrity over time.

Before requesting house leveling, property owners often seek information about the scope of work, including whether the project involves lifting the entire foundation or specific sections. Clarifying the causes of uneven settling, the materials and techniques involved, and the potential impact on nearby structures can help homeowners make informed decisions. Understanding these aspects ensures that the project effectively restores stability and prevents future issues related to shifting or sinking foundations.

What is house leveling? House leveling involves adjusting a building’s foundation to correct uneven settling, ensuring stability and safety.

When is house leveling needed? It is typically required when a home shows signs of uneven floors, cracks in walls, or other foundation issues.

What methods are used for house leveling? Common methods include pier and beam jacking, mudjacking, and underpinning to restore levelness.

How can property owners tell if their house needs leveling? Indicators include sloping floors, cracked walls, or doors and windows that don’t close properly.
